Growth Phases in Children and How They Benefit Smile Correction
Children undergo multiple growth stages that influence the effectiveness of clear aligners. Recognizing these stages allows orthodontists to maximize treatment benefits.
- Primary Dentition (Ages 3–6): Early smile correction prevents harmful habits like thumb sucking or tongue thrusting and reduces the risk of misaligned teeth in permanent dentition.
- Mixed Dentition (Ages 6–12): Corrective treatments guide jaw growth, optimize space for permanent teeth, and prevent overcrowding, ensuring proper bite development.
- Early Adolescence (Ages 12–14): During this phase, most permanent teeth have erupted, making it possible to achieve balanced alignment, improve facial symmetry, and enhance self-esteem.
By aligning treatment with growth phases, children benefit from functional improvements, aesthetic enhancements, and reduced treatment complexity.
Functional Benefits of Early Teeth Alignment
Proper alignment and bite correction during growth phases improve overall oral function. Functional benefits include:
- Improved Chewing and Digestion: Correct tooth alignment ensures efficient chewing, supporting better nutrition and overall health.
- Jaw Harmony: Guiding jaw growth reduces bite issues, prevents temporomandibular joint (TMJ) problems, and balances facial proportions.
- Airway Health: Early correction can improve airway function, reducing the risk of sleep-disordered breathing and promoting healthy breathing patterns.
- Speech Development: Proper tooth and jaw alignment helps children pronounce words clearly, preventing speech difficulties.
Functional benefits of clear aligners during growth phases create lasting health advantages that extend beyond childhood, improving both oral efficiency and overall wellness.

Long-Term Health Benefits of Clear Aligners
Early clear aligners contribute to oral health that lasts well into adulthood. Key long-term benefits include:
- Reduced Tooth Decay Risk: Properly aligned teeth are easier to clean, reducing cavities and gum disease.
- Balanced Bite: Correct alignment distributes bite forces evenly, preventing excessive wear on individual teeth.
- Lower Risk of Future Orthodontic Procedures: Early interventions often eliminate the need for complex corrective treatments in adulthood.
- Sustainable Oral Health: Guided growth ensures teeth, gums, and jaws develop in harmony, supporting lifelong dental stability.
Investing in smile correction during growth phases not only solves immediate dental issues but also protects a child’s oral health and facial development for the future.
